Study of SYS6023 for advanced solid tumors

Advanced Solid Tumor

Part of Cancer clinical trials.

This trial tests a new drug called SYS6023 for people with advanced solid tumors that have not responded to standard treatments. It may be an option if your tumor has a specific protein called HER3 or certain genetic changes.

Phase
Phase 1
Enrollment
400 people
Ages
18 years and older
Study type
Interventional

Who can take part

  • You must be 18 years or older.
  • You must have a solid tumor that has spread or cannot be removed with surgery, and standard treatments have stopped working.
  • You need to provide a tumor sample (from a past biopsy or a new one) to check for HER3 and other markers.
  • Depending on the type of cancer and its genetic features, you may need to have received certain prior treatments (e.g., hormone therapy, targeted therapy, or chemotherapy).
  • You must have at least one tumor that can be measured on scans, and be in reasonably good health (able to walk and take care of yourself).
  • You must have adequate organ function (kidneys, liver, heart, and blood counts) as shown by blood tests.
